The Blue Highway

You learn more about an area by traveling the roads through it than by reading the map about it.  Traveling down to South Carolina we decided to take the “Blue Highway” through some small towns. Route 501S/301S to 14 to 41S led to a town named Johnsonville where the main trades appear to be Deer, Hog, and Alligator Processing, followed closely by large billboards advertising Car Crushing.

And, we wonder why the differences in America seem insurmountable.
